BEACON MINERALS LIMITED - JAURDI GOLD PROJECT DECEMBER QUARTER PRODUCTION UPDATE

BCN.AX

Beacon Minerals Limited (ASX: BCN) is pleased to provide an update of activities at the 100% owned Jaurdi Gold Project.

Record throughput was achieved in the December 2021 quarter, mill throughput was 72% above the Company's prefeasibility study. Full year guidance for 21/22 remains at 24,000 to 28,000 ozs. Increased mill throughputs is allowing more low grade ore to be processed whilst balancing mill feed grades and recoveries.
